Rest API Time out was reached while connecting Google Big Query as a data source in Power BI Desktop
Hi All,
While connecting Google Big Query in power BI desktop, I am getting this error as shown in below. As per microsoft docs if we want to connect Google Big query in Power BI desktop it requires Google account ([email protected]), for that here i am using my personal mail as google account. I am using Power BI desktop Version: 2.93.641.0 64-bit (May 2021). So how to troubleshoot the below error, Any one please help me on this. Thanks in advance.

I have also used my personal mail as google account, and I cannot reproduce your issue.
My desktop version: 2.99.862.0 64-bit (November 2021)
- Effective July 2021, Google will discontinue support for sign-ins to Google accounts from embedded browser frameworks. Due to this change, you will need to update your Power BI Desktop version to June 2021 to support signing in to Google.
-
Capabilities supported: import and Direct Query.
